Output 8d9590759e0671b00d1eab768b8ab7c104b63df382bbaed30bc6dc084828ab51:26

value
159368
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e13b89a91138618a2b5d3b122d97df676a2bb09 OP_EQUALVERIFY OP_CHECKSIG
address
1DxEaVDnkCTQGBjCPnynhh6bhqw7gNjn7n
transaction
8d9590759e0671b00d1eab768b8ab7c104b63df382bbaed30bc6dc084828ab51
spent
true